public class AuthTokenUpdateSQL extends UpdateSqlHandler
| コンストラクタと説明 |
|---|
AuthTokenUpdateSQL() |
| 修飾子とタイプ | メソッドと説明 |
|---|---|
java.lang.String |
createDeleteByDateSQL() |
java.lang.String |
createDeleteBySeriesSQL() |
java.lang.String |
createDeleteSQL() |
java.lang.String |
createInsertSQL() |
java.lang.String |
createUpdateStrictSQL() |
void |
setDeleteByDateParameter(RdbAdapter rdb,
java.sql.PreparedStatement ps,
int tenantId,
java.lang.String type,
java.sql.Timestamp date) |
void |
setDeleteBySeriesParameter(RdbAdapter rdb,
java.sql.PreparedStatement ps,
int tenantId,
java.lang.String type,
java.lang.String series) |
void |
setDeleteParameter(RdbAdapter rdb,
java.sql.PreparedStatement ps,
int tenantId,
java.lang.String type,
java.lang.String uniqueKey) |
void |
setInsertParameter(RdbAdapter rdb,
java.sql.PreparedStatement ps,
AuthToken token,
boolean saveDetailAsJson,
com.fasterxml.jackson.databind.ObjectMapper om) |
void |
setUpdateStrictParameter(RdbAdapter rdb,
java.sql.PreparedStatement ps,
AuthToken newToken,
AuthToken currentToken,
boolean saveDetailAsJson,
com.fasterxml.jackson.databind.ObjectMapper om) |
(package private) byte[] |
toBin(java.io.Serializable obj) |
public java.lang.String createInsertSQL()
public void setInsertParameter(RdbAdapter rdb, java.sql.PreparedStatement ps, AuthToken token, boolean saveDetailAsJson, com.fasterxml.jackson.databind.ObjectMapper om) throws java.sql.SQLException, com.fasterxml.jackson.core.JsonProcessingException
java.sql.SQLExceptioncom.fasterxml.jackson.core.JsonProcessingExceptionpublic java.lang.String createDeleteSQL()
public void setDeleteParameter(RdbAdapter rdb, java.sql.PreparedStatement ps, int tenantId, java.lang.String type, java.lang.String uniqueKey) throws java.sql.SQLException
java.sql.SQLExceptionpublic java.lang.String createDeleteBySeriesSQL()
public void setDeleteBySeriesParameter(RdbAdapter rdb, java.sql.PreparedStatement ps, int tenantId, java.lang.String type, java.lang.String series) throws java.sql.SQLException
java.sql.SQLExceptionpublic java.lang.String createDeleteByDateSQL()
public void setDeleteByDateParameter(RdbAdapter rdb, java.sql.PreparedStatement ps, int tenantId, java.lang.String type, java.sql.Timestamp date) throws java.sql.SQLException
java.sql.SQLExceptionpublic java.lang.String createUpdateStrictSQL()
public void setUpdateStrictParameter(RdbAdapter rdb, java.sql.PreparedStatement ps, AuthToken newToken, AuthToken currentToken, boolean saveDetailAsJson, com.fasterxml.jackson.databind.ObjectMapper om) throws java.sql.SQLException, com.fasterxml.jackson.core.JsonProcessingException
java.sql.SQLExceptioncom.fasterxml.jackson.core.JsonProcessingExceptionbyte[] toBin(java.io.Serializable obj)